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

From the 1930s through the 1970s, asbestos was widely used in building materials. It was used in pipe insulation, fireproofing, cements, plasters, car breaks, and more. The exposure to this dangerous mineral can cause several severe medical conditions like mesothelioma, and other respiratory illnesses.

A New York mesothelioma attorney can help victims receive compensation from companies that are responsible for their exposure. It is essential to choose the right attorney for filing this type of claim.

Find a specialist

Asbest fibers can be inhaled when they are extracted and processed. This can lead to lung cancer, asbestosis and mesothelioma. People who handle asbestos directly are more at risk, however anyone can breathe asbestos. This kind of exposure, also known as secondary exposure, can affect anyone around the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This includes family members who wash the uniform and anyone who lives in the same home. This could happen on ships and bases of military, where workers wear the same clothing for a long period of time.

Asbestos can be a problem for those who work in shipyards, construction, mills and also in mining, insulation, and other industries. This was especially true in the United States from the 1950s to the 1990s. Workers were exposed to asbestos when older buildings were renovated or demolished as well as when building materials were damaged. materials. Even the present day, demolition and renovation in older buildings could release asbestos into the atmosphere.

It can be a long period of time between exposure to asbestos and mesothelioma onset symptoms or other signs. It is important to consult a doctor when you've been exposed to asbestos or think you might be suffering from any of the diseases associated with it.

Your doctor will listen to your lungs and inquire about any work history that may have involved asbestos. If they suspect that you have an asbestos related illness, they could refer you to a specialist for more tests. Asbestos-related diseases can be identified through chest X-rays or CT scans. However, they may not show up in these tests.

These diseases can affect the lungs, heart and abdomen. It is not common for mesothelioma to develop in the brain.

Some experts believe that the best way to avoid exposure to asbestos is to avoid all forms of dust and to never smoke or work in an industry which might make use of it. Other experts believe that this is not possible and that people should be checked often for signs of asbestos-related illnesses.

Search for a firm that practices nationwide

Asbestos was utilized in a wide range of industries until it was discovered that the material was dangerous. Asbestos is a natural substance, but when it becomes disturbed, it releases microscopic fibers that are inhaled or ingested. This can lead to a variety of medical conditions, including Mesothelioma and lung cancer. Those who worked in asbestos-impacted industries are at higher risk, and even those who were in schools or homes where asbestos was present are vulnerable to these diseases.

If you are making an asbestos lawsuit, it is vital that the victim find the appropriate lawyer for their case.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ases have the resources, skills and experience required to effectively build a claim. They also have the relationships and know-how to locate the most suitable defendants.

An experienced attorney will evaluate your specific asbestos exposure to determine what you are entitled to. This includes a claim for premises liability if you suffered exposure at work, property damage if your home was contaminated, as well as product liability in the event that you were exposed asbestos from a product sold to consumers.

A New York attorney can also assist you in determining what kind of legal action is most suitable for your particular situation. You could make a personal injury lawsuit or wrongful death suit based on the location and the manner in which you were harmed.

The location where you were exposed to asbestos is a significant aspect in the worth of your case, but there are other factors that are also important. The length of your exposure and the identity of the liable parties will be key factors in determining the amount of settlement.

Report Your Suspicion to Your Employer

Asbestos is a fibrous substance used in many industrial applications because of its resistance to heat as well as its flexibility and strength. Unfortunately, asbestos law can also cause serious health issues such as mesothelioma or lung cancer. These diseases can be painful, debilitating and often fatal. Patients who have been exposed to asbestos may be entitled to compensation. A successful lawsuit could pay for medical expenses and lost wages, as well as home care costs, and much more.

Workers who have been exposed to asbestos should report any symptoms of illness right away. This is particularly important for construction workers, who are frequently exposed asbestos when renovating old buildings. These buildings were built before asbestos was recognized as a carcinogen that could cause harm and could contain dangerous levels of asbestos.

Exposure to asbestos legal may cause a variety of ailments. Symptoms usually do not show up until 25 to 50 years after exposure. Therefore, people who have been exposed to asbestos should schedule regular health checks with a physician. This is the best way to prevent the development of asbestos-related illnesses or to identify any early warning signs.

Some people are more susceptible to asbestos exposure than others. Navy veterans, for example might have been exposed to asbestos while serving on ships and other military facilities. Asbestos has also been found in workers at shipyards as well as heating systems, construction or the automotive industry.

There are numerous agencies that create laws and regulations for employers to follow when it comes asbestos in the workplace. If you suspect your employer isn't adhering to these standards, contact the Occupational Safety and Health Administration for more information or to request an inspection.

Certain veterans who served in the United States Armed Forces are also eligible for disability compensation. Veterans who qualify can file claims for benefits due to asbestos exposure while working in the VA.

Claim Your Claim

Your lawyer will collect your health history as well as employment records to create an outline of your exposure to asbestos. Then, they will construct your case by gathering evidence that proves that you were exposed and that exposure led to harm. The complaint will be sent to every defendant and they will be given 30 days to respond. Defendants typically deny liability and may attempt to blame the other party. This is why you require an attorney team that know how to deal with these denials.

Once they have all the required documents, your attorney will file your asbestos lawsuit. They will file it with the state court system that best suits your case. During this time period, the attorneys will collect evidence and conduct discovery, where they will exchange information regarding the case with the opposing side. They may also argue your case in trial if they decide to go to trial. However, the majority of cases settle by settling an asbestos lawsuit.

It is essential to employ a mesothelioma expert because asbestos litigation is distinct from other personal injury claims. They have access to a database that informs patients what specific asbestos-related products they used during their work. It is much easier for patients to recognize the specific products responsible for their asbestos exposure.

They also know which companies are responsible for your exposure. This includes the makers of asbestos-containing products you handled, as well as the owners of buildings that contain as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os case-contaminated products.
